WBI Energy is proposing to replace four sections, totaling 5.6 miles of its existing 12-inch diameter Elk Basin-Billings mainline pipeline between the Monad Station and the North Yellowstone River Valve Setting in Yellowstone County, Montana as shown on the Billings Project Overview map in Figure 1-1 Project Overview drawing (attached). It is approximately 13 miles between the North Yellowstone River Valve Setting and the Monad Station. These replacement segments include: Section 1: 0.9 mile (4,880 feet) between the Monad Station (station no. 0+00) and mainline station no. 48+80; Section 2: 2.0 miles (10,497 feet) between mainline station nos. 59+00 to 163+97; Section 3: 1.7 miles (8,707 feet) between mainline station no. 211+60 and a tie-in with the existing mainline pipeline at station no. 298+67; and Section 4 (CHS Section): 1.0 mile (5,284 feet) between the Yellowstone River Valve Setting to the Laurel Town Border Station (station nos. 1+48 to 54+32).1 The above-described replacement meets the definition of a “new or entirely replaced onshore transmission pipeline segment” and portions of the replacement fall within Class 3 and HCA locations therefore meeting the applicability of §192.634 for rupture mitigation valves (RMV) and AET.
